temperatures

 
Noun temperature has 2 senses
  1. temperature - the degree of hotness or coldness of a body or environment (corresponding to its molecular activity)
    --1 is a kind of
    fundamental quantity, fundamental measure; physical property
    --1 has particulars:
     absolute temperature; absolute zero; Curie temperature, Curie point; dew point; flash point, flashpoint; freezing point, melting point; boiling point, boil; mercury; room temperature; simmer; body temperature, blood heat; coldness, cold, low temperature; hotness, heat, high temperature
  2. temperature - the somatic sensation of cold or heat
    --2 is a kind of
    somesthesia, somaesthesia, somatesthesia, somatic sensation
    --2 has particulars: heat, warmth; cold, coldness; comfort zone
